In Vietnam, each part usually has its own kind of way to speak words, and they have many different dialects. I am from the North, but when I went to the mid-part and south-part of Vietnam, people talked, but I could not understand even it was Vietnamese. Fortunately, I know many friends in many places in Vietnam by game, and they helped me a lot about it. They taught me many slang words and how to pronounce them.
